PURL IC woRirs <br />September 23, 1997 <br />Mr. Dan Balmelli <br />Barghausen Engineers <br />18215 72nd Avenue S <br />Kent, WA 98032 <br />Subject: Homebase Rough Grading and Temporary Erosion/Sedimentation Control Plan <br />Dear Mr. Balmelli: <br />The proposed plan and temporary facilities do not provide for the replacement of the wetland's <br />stormwater-related functions. The existing wetland's stormwater detention functions are critical, <br />particularly during the wet season. The subject plan proposes to convey, directly downstream, <br />the stormwater runoff currently detained in the wetland. In order to avoid downstream flooding <br />and erosion, the wetland must not be filled until the design and construction of the permanent <br />facilities. Given the time of the year and the characteristics of the site, it is unlikely that <br />construction of the permanent facilities can be constructed until next spring/summer. <br />Please do not hesitate to contact us if further clarification would be helpful. <br />Sincerely, <br />Larry. raw ord, <br />Engineering/Public Services Director <br />GW:Iudw(Wpdu.U) <br />CITY OF EVERETT• 3200 Cedar Street 9 Everett, WA 98201 • (425) 257-8800 • Fax (425) 257-8856 <br />
